Output 1077c6037a6226cf486beade8992e5b32c62e6fa8969170716a468333077da66:3

value
3300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2962b33a36da2adbef28844e84607595024fa676 OP_EQUAL
address
35TqsDGyhGuQC6afw5qvaGNvjGtwHgkhaG
transaction
1077c6037a6226cf486beade8992e5b32c62e6fa8969170716a468333077da66
confirmations
250083
spent
true